What to know about dairy farm business loans in Sioux Falls

Sioux Falls dairy operators usually fall into one of four buckets: cash flow support, equipment or automation, herd acquisition, or land and debt structure. The lender’s first question is simple: what asset or revenue stream pays this back? That is why the application process for dairy farm loans changes so much from one request to the next. A line of credit that covers feed and payroll is not the same thing as a note for robotic milkers, and neither one behaves like farm real estate financing.

Need Usually fits What separates it
Feed, payroll, milk-check timing Working capital line Usually priced around 18-22% APR; lenders often review 2-6 months of bank statements
Robotic milkers, parlors, trailers, cooling systems Dairy farm technology financing or equipment debt Strong credit can price around 8-11% APR; fair credit often lands closer to 12-16% APR
Buying cows or expanding the herd Cow acquisition loans or herd expansion loans Equipment and livestock are usually self-collateralizing, but the herd ramp must support cash flow
Land, barns, refinance, or consolidation Farm real estate financing or USDA farm service agency loans USDA FSA farm ownership loans can go up to 95% LTV, which matters when equity is thin

The best dairy farm lenders 2026 are the ones that understand agricultural cycles, not just generic business credit. If your debt service is already near 40-45% of gross monthly revenue, a lender will usually get cautious fast, even if the project looks good on paper. For equipment-heavy deals, a 1.25x debt service coverage ratio and 640+ FICO are common starting points, and clean files can move in 5-30 days. That is why a simple, collateral-matched request often closes faster than a large mixed-use ask.

If your request sits closer to a business refinance than a new purchase, some borrowers also use SBA 7(a) for the business portion of the deal. In that lane, expect 8-11% APR, a 30-45 day processing window, a 24-month time-in-business test, and a $5,000,000 cap. For dairy farms that are trying to preserve liquidity, the practical question is not just the rate; it is whether the loan keeps cash available through feed swings, vet costs, and seasonal production changes.

Frequently asked questions

What loan fits a dairy herd purchase?

Use herd-expansion or equipment-backed term debt when the animals and production ramp can support repayment. If cash flow is tight, a working capital line is usually the cleaner fit.

What do lenders usually want to see on a dairy loan file?

Many commercial dairy lenders want 640+ FICO, at least 1.25x debt service coverage, and 2-6 months of bank statements. Strong collateral and clean herd records help.

How fast can dairy equipment financing close?

A clean equipment file can move in 5-30 days. The fastest approvals usually happen when the equipment is specified, the down payment is ready, and the repayment source is obvious.
